Abused the Rating System...Follow

#1 May 19 2008 at 9:32 PM Rating: Excellent
Without meaning to.

I was at 1814 with my priest partner. Decided to include a Druid in the mix.

1814 + 1814 + 1500 /3 = 1709.

Fighting 10 points team for easy win?

Yup yup.

10 games later, team is at 1933, the druid's personal rating is at 1722, so still 211 points short of the team's rating... meaning we should be able to hit 2k in 7 more games, fighting team that give us 9-11 points.

GG Rating system, GG.
